Output 12ea29ae99aac119cbd5a2b393fa3be0e0332ebe854591c7eb11eef8f883cd47:0

value
630707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4c54349af94161edefd96e86814147959de123 OP_EQUAL
address
3HacwMCgqMEYLaBzSAqpfobKncwdHJXgh8
transaction
12ea29ae99aac119cbd5a2b393fa3be0e0332ebe854591c7eb11eef8f883cd47
spent
true